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
48780908 375663 37545
106978 037782837 0283863
106978 037782837 0283863
4419 48660674 41838
All about undefined
Interested in learning more?
106978 037782837 0283863
4419 48660674 41838
See more
1142 015499609 6160
48217 530299859 78
See more
849102128 74393628 495
71421834561 210 1434737 179
See more